Key Responsibilities

  • •Own and manage product catalogue data across European markets.
  • •Ensure alignment between SAP codes, EAN/GTINs, ASINs, vendor codes, and marketplace structures.
  • •Establish and maintain catalogue governance standards, processes, and controls; act as custodian of product master data and single source of truth.
  • •Monitor catalogue quality and resolve duplicate ASINs, mapping errors, listing issues, and variation inconsistencies.
  • •Lead catalogue execution for lifecycle events (NPD launches, reformulations, packaging changes, regulatory updates, delistings) and drive process improvements/automation across SAP, PIM platforms, and Amazon Vendor Central.

Key Requirements

  • •3 to 5+ years of experience in eCommerce, Amazon Vendor/Seller Central, or Product Master Data Management.
  • •Strong understanding of product data structures, including SAP, EAN/GTIN, and ASIN management.
  • •Experience with PIM solutions such as Salsify, Syndigo, or equivalent platforms.
  • •Solid knowledge of Amazon catalogue architecture, listings, variations, and product mapping.
  • •Advanced Excel and strong data management capabilities.
